About Elstree

Elstree is a village located in Hertfordshire, England, within the WD6 postcode area. It is situated just north of London, making it easily accessible for those travelling to the capital. The village has a mix of residential areas and open spaces, providing a pleasant environment for both locals and visitors. Elstree is known for its proximity to various film and television studios, which have contributed to its recognition in the entertainment industry.

The local amenities include shops, schools, and parks, catering to the needs of the community. Elstree also has a railway station that connects it to central London, making it a convenient location for commuters. The village features a number of historic buildings, reflecting its development over the years. Overall, Elstree offers a blend of suburban living with easy access to urban conveniences.

Household Income in Elstree ONS 2023

The average total household income in Elstree is approximately £62,820 a year before tax, 14% above the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£46,742.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Elstree ONS 2025

There are approximately 3,275 active businesses based in Elstree, around 79 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 91%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 65 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Elstree

Of the 16,021 households in and around Elstree, 55% are owned, 26% are socially rented and 19% are privately rented. Home ownership here is lower than the England and Wales average of 63%.

Owned 55% Social rented 26% Private rented 19%

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Elstree.
